Correspondence with Michael Wardell : April - June 1962. 1962 Apr. 16 - June 7.

Letters, telegrams, soundscribers, invoice and newspaper clippings concerning the arguments against Britain joining the common market; Diefenbaker, his involvement with the Chignecto Canal, his re-election and Beaverbrook's prediction of Diefenbaker's defeat; the Canada Council grant to the Beaverbrook Art Gallery; Beaverbrook's opposition to an abstract art exhibition {81279}; the success of the Atlantic Advocate; reprinting a review of the Divine Propagandist; Prince Dimitri's satirization in a review; a fire destroying Wardell's home in Wales; the federal Atlantic Development Board; Joey Smallwood's objection to Donald Fleming's speaking at a Rotary Club function and Wardell's assessment of A.W. Trueman as an unreliable New Brunswick representative to the Canada Council.

Michael Wardell joined the Beaverbrook newspapers in London in 1926 after a career in the military. With the outbreak of the Second World War he rejoined the army and finally retired with the rank of Brigadier in 1946. He returned to Fleet Street and eventually became vice-chairman to the Beaverbrook organization. In 1950 he came to Fredericton and bought the Daily Gleaner.
